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
217633703 193 394443429 33 08665971
4605262 19824
4605262 19824
25417 604805292 421573
All about undefined
Interested in learning more?
4605262 19824
25417 604805292 421573
See more
7604 546 273153
05074 9602897 14886
See more
05 742316572 5859817184
08826 44072 066324474
See more